Headquartered in Houston, Texas, Summit Midstream Corporation (NYSE: SMC) is a value-driven corporation focused on developing, owning and operating midstream energy infrastructure assets that are strategically located in unconventional resource basins, primarily shale formations, in the continental United States.

We currently operate natural gas, crude oil and produced water gathering systems in four unconventional resource basins:

  1. the Williston Basin in North Dakota, which includes the Bakken and Three Forks shale formations;
  2. the Denver-Julesburg Basin, which includes the Niobrara and Codell shale formations in Colorado and Wyoming;
  3. the Fort Worth Basin in Texas, which includes the Barnett Shale formation; and
  4. the Piceance Basin in Colorado, which includes the liquids-rich Mesaverde formation as well as the emerging Mancos and Niobrara Shale formations.

Our systems and the basins they serve are as follows:

  1. the Polar & Divide system, which serves the Williston Basin;
  2. the DFW Midstream system, which serves the Fort Worth Basin;
  3. the Grand River system, which serves the Piceance Basin; and
  4. the Niobrara G&P system, which serves the DJ Basin.

SMC has an equity investment in and operates Double E Pipeline, LLC, which is natural gas transmission infrastructure that provides transportation service from multiple receipt points in the Delaware Basin to various delivery points in and around the Waha Hub in Texas.

We generate a substantial majority of our revenue under primarily long-term and fee-based gathering agreements with our customers. The majority of our gathering agreements are underpinned by areas of mutual interest (“AMIs”) and minimum volume commitments (“MVCs”). Our AMIs provide that any production drilled by our customers within the AMIs will be shipped on our gathering systems. The MVCs are designed to ensure that we will generate a minimum amount of gathering revenue over the life of each respective gathering agreement. The fee-based nature of the majority of the gathering agreements enhances the stability of our cash flows and limits our direct commodity price exposure.

Since our formation in 2009, our management team has established a track record of executing this strategy through the acquisition and subsequent development of DFW Midstream, Grand River, Polar & Divide, Niobrara G&P, and Double E Pipeline.

Summary:

This position is responsible for the allocation of gas plant products, volumes and values accounting and reporting of financial information relating to Summit’s gas plant activities. The role involves collaboration with various operations, marketing, commercial and external customers who may be processors, purchasers or sellers of the produced residue gas and ngl's. The position involves ensuring that the outputs are complete, accurate and timely while at same time ensuring that organizational goals are met in a cost-effective manner and that the accounting records are in compliance with contractual agreements, GAAP, SOX and Company Policy & Procedures. The job requires a proactive, self-starter who can work independently with good decision-making skills while interpreting and analyzing information surrounding the recognition, delivery, processing, and allocation of all volumes handled at each plant. This job also requires a team player with high standards of excellence and attention to detail.

Principle Duties & Responsibilities:

  1. Perform monthly plant volume allocations as well as produce customer invoices and reporting, process PPA's as necessary.
  2. Monitor producer volume commitments and bill for any shortfalls that may occur.
  3. Maintain superior customer relations with external customers by addressing customer issues and providing accurate and timely information to customers.
  4. Work with commercial operations as well as field operations to gain a solid understanding of gas processing contracts and processes.
  5. Respond to audit queries as required.
  6. Interact with Gas Plant Operations, Commercial and Gas Measurement to ensure accuracy and completeness of data.
  7. Maintain/Follow SOX documentation as well as compliance with the documented processes.
